David L. Andre - President & CEO

An experienced entrepreneur and executive with more than twenty years’ experience building and growing successful Internet and technology businesses, David Andre co-founded Mall Networks in 2005. A recognized expert in Internet search and e-commerce, David was founding CTO of Upromise, the largest and most successful coalition loyalty program in the United States. At Upromise, David was responsible for one of the company’s most critical business processes – the development and evolution of Upromise’s technology platform. At Upromise, David also managed ongoing business, technology and partner operations. He developed and implemented the business model for Upromise Online Shopping, one of the Internet’s most successful online e-commerce sites.

Prior to Upromise, David served as VP of Engineering at Lycos (acquired by Terra Networks SA) and Direct Hit (acquired by Ask Jeeves). Prior to this, David held senior technology roles at Rational Software (acquired by IBM), Object Design (acquired by Progress Software) and Symbolics. He also served four years in the U.S. Air Force at National Security Agency.

David holds a M.S.C.S. from the University of Maryland and a B.S.E.E. from the Massachusetts Institute of Technology.

Ben Kaplan - Chief Operating Officer

As Chief Operating Officer, Ben is responsible for client services, product development, marketing, merchant relations and business development at Mall Networks. Prior to assuming the role of COO, Ben served as Chief Marketing Officer at Mall Networks.

Ben brings 15 years of marketing, product management and business development experience in a wide range of high tech markets including e-Commerce, CRM, Social Networking, Search, Content Management, Business Intelligence and Analytics.

Before Mall Networks, Ben was Vice President of Marketing at KNOVA Software, a leading provider of customer service, self-service and intelligent search applications. At KNOVA, Ben helped grow the company from 5 to 200 customers and established the product suite as an award-winning market leader prior to the company's acquisition by Battery Ventures and Consona in December 2006.

Earlier in his career, Ben held executive and management positions at North Systems, Broadbase/KANA and Commerce One.

Ben holds a BA from Harvard College.

Ron Barale - VP of Engineering

As Vice President of Engineering, Ron Barale is responsible for all software engineering activities at Mall Networks. Ron brings more than 25 years of experience leading product development and services organizations in the CRM, ecommerce, business intelligence, and enterprise search industries.

Ron was most recently the Vice President of Product Development at Inquira, where he led engineering for their suite of search, knowledge management and web self-service products. He was formerly the senior vice president of product development for Epiphany, where he was responsible for developing the company’s innovative suite of CRM products, including marketing automation, predictive analytics and CRM. Ron also held other key executive roles at Epiphany, including serving as Epiphany’s senior vice president of customer management and education, where he was responsible for the worldwide operations of Epiphany’s Customer Management & Education organization.

Prior to Epiphany, Ron was Vice President of product engineering and support at Red Brick Systems, a database and data warehouse technology developer acquired by IBM. At Red Brick, he ran worldwide operations of the development organization, customer support, and corporate MIS functions. Ron has also held engineering management positions at Blue Roads Corp., a SaaS-based channel management platform, Compuware, and COMAC.

Marc Caltabiano - VP of Marketing

As Vice President of Marketing, Marc Caltabiano is responsible for product strategy, product management, product marketing, marketing communications, and public relations. Marc brings more than 15 years of product management and product marketing experience in the CRM, self-service, ecommerce, and enterprise search industries. He holds nine patents on search and knowledge management.

Prior to Mall Networks, Marc was the senior director of product management at KNOVA Software, guiding the company's product and positioning strategy, product roadmap, and product and release management. In this role, he was responsible for award-winning and market-changing products and solutions that helped grow the company's revenue by more than 400 percent.

Before KNOVA, Marc served as senior product manager at Siebel Systems for the Call Center and eService products and was a key part of the team that vaulted Siebel's Call Center and eService products into a market leadership position.

Marc started his career with Disco Corporation, a leading Japanese semiconductor equipment manufacturer, based in Tokyo.

Marc has a B.A. from Williams College and an MBA from the Haas School at the University of California at Berkeley.

Ann Calvit - VP of Technical Services

Ann Calvit brings nearly two decades of experience in product, partnership and strategic account management in the e-commerce, loyalty marketing, financial services and advanced supercomputing sectors to Mall Networks.

Ann is responsible for technical services and operations for all of Mall Networks' clients. In this role, she manages programs spanning numerous organizational disciplines, including product delivery, infrastructure testing and compliance and quality control and assurance. Ann most recently served as VP of Technology Integrations for Sports Loyalty Systems (SLS), an operator and marketer of loyalty programs for professional sports leagues and their franchises. There, she managed technical partner relationships of both outsourcers and contributing partners, including Chase and FMI/ADS.

Prior to SLS, Ann spent nearly three years at Upromise as VP of Technology Integrations where she was responsible for quantifying business needs and establishing the ROI for multiple value-add package evaluations. Earlier in her career, Ann held senior technical positions at Open Market, Kendall Square Research and mValent.

Ann holds a B.S. in Computer Science from American University of Paris.

Kristyn Golier - VP of Merchant Development

Kristyn Golier brings nearly a decade of affiliate marketing experience to Mall Networks and its clients. During her career, Kristyn has forged successful loyalty rewards programs with several of the world’s top consumer brands and online retailers.

Prior to joining Mall Networks, Kristyn was the Director of Online Shopping at Upromise, the largest coalition loyalty program in the U.S. During her tenure at Upromise, Kristyn managed the company’s online mall and helped to increase the mall’s revenues by more than 400 percent. She also helped to more than double the number of merchants participating in the Online Shopping program. Kristyn strengthened relationships with many of Upromise’s key online merchants, including JCPenney.com, Lands’ End, Sears.com, Target.com and Walmart.com by developing new revenue generating programs for these merchants that helped significantly increase web site traffic and transaction volumes. As a result, Online Shopping became one the largest and fastest revenue generators for Upromise.

Prior to Upromise, Kristyn was responsible for e-commerce at Schoolpop. Kristyn significantly enhanced and expanded Schoolpop’s online merchant partnerships through direct mail and other innovative consumer marketing programs.

Ping Lay - Chief Architect

Ping Lay has more than twenty years’ experience in managing and developing software systems, including personalization, e-commerce and automated testing.

Prior to co-founding Mall Networks, Ping was an independent computer consultant working for the federal government (DOT). Previously, Ping was Engineering Manager at Lycos, where he architected and directed development of the “My Lycos” personalized portal, as well as vertical web sites such as Lycos Finance and Lycos News. Prior to joining Lycos, Ping was a Senior Software Engineer at Rational Software. At Rational, Ping was responsible for the client-server load testing products line.

Ping received his M.B.A and B.S. in Computer Engineering from Boston University.

John Mangan - VP of Financial Markets

As vice president of financial markets, John oversees the development of new business with top financial services firms, including consumer credit card, banking, and insurance organizations. He has more than 20 years of experience in building and negotiating affinity partnerships and loyalty marketing programs.

Previous to joining Mall Networks, John was VP of new business development at The Kessler Group, where he developed partnership solutions for clients and prospects in the financial services arena, focusing on leveraging affinity partner assets to maximize revenue and customer satisfaction. He also developed co-marketing agreements between Kessler clients and various marketing solutions companies to improve acquisition and loyalty marketing results. Prior to The Kessler Group, Mangan spent 17 years at MBNA America most recently as marketing director for product development. In this capacity, he developed and implemented new products and credit card loyalty programs for large affinity groups. Also at MBNA, Mangan had extensive experience partnering with Visa, MasterCard, and American Express to maximize cardholder value propositions and customer loyalty.

Mangan holds a bachelor of science in marketing and finance from University of Delaware. He has served on various committees for the Ronald McDonald House.

Kimathi Marangu - EVP of Business Development

Kimathi Marangu is a recognized expert in loyalty marketing, affiliate marketing and e-commerce. Kimathi has been a contributor to Colloquy, DMNews and MarketingProfs, interviewed by Fox Business News, and quoted in USA Today, BusinessWeek.com, New York Newsday, Red Herring and others.

Prior to co-founding Mall Networks, he ran a consulting business, Seaspray, whose clients include Apple and Teleflora. Kimathi grew Apple's affiliate program into one of the largest in the industry. He also established Apple's U.S. search and comparison shopping partnerships with Google, Yahoo! Shopping, Shopzilla, Overture, Shopping.com and PriceGrabber.

Previously, Kimathi was GM of eCommerce at Schoolpop, an online school fundraising company. There he refined the business model that delivered over $250 million in trackable, multi-channel sales to merchants, raising millions of dollars for schools. He began his career as an investment banker at Morgan Stanley and J.P. Morgan in New York and Australia. A wildlife conservationist, he has served as Special Assistant to Dr. Richard Leakey at the Kenya Wildlife Service.

Kimathi has his A.B. in Economics from Vassar College and his M.B.A. from Stanford Graduate School of Business, where he is past President of the Stanford Business School Alumni Association and Emeritus Member of the Business School Advisory Council.

Mike Morin - SVP of Sales

As Senior Vice President of Worldwide Sales, Mike Morin brings more than 25 years of experience to Mall Networks. As SVP of Worldwide Sales, Mike is responsible for the company's direct, channel, and inside sales groups, as well as sales operations.

Prior to Mall Networks, Mike was SVP of Sales at CXO Systems, a VC backed application software development company focused on operational performance, enterprise risk and regulatory compliance. There he managed the direct, indirect, partner and inside sales teams and was responsible for driving new business growth in the Fortune 1000.

Previously, Mike served as Executive Vice President, Worldwide Sales & Marketing at Demantra, a supplier of Demand Planning and Trade Promotion Management Software. In addition to his sales responsibilities, Mike created the Demantra Center of Excellence, and managed the Marketing group that was responsible for product positioning, and demand generation activities.

Mike has served as a key member of several executive teams and was instrumental in driving early stage company growth through successful IPOs for i2 Technologies and i-Cube/Razorfish. Mike holds an MBA and BS degree from the University of Massachusetts.

Erin Raese - VP of In-Store Programs

Erin Raese is a veteran of in-store loyalty programs with more than 18 years experience in loyalty marketing and in-store programs. Most recently, she was Vice President of Marketing Services at SHCDirect where she was responsible for the company’s merchant partnership sales, communications and rewards strategy. At SHCDirect, Raese developed a partnership sales department, creating – and maintaining -- over 650 relationships with top retailers, restaurants, and service providers. Raese’s marketing experience began at Hyatt Corporation, where she managed the Hyatt Resorts loyalty marketing efforts. After Hyatt, Erin held a number of key marketing management positions, where she was responsible for design and development of rewards based loyalty programs.

Erin holds a degree in Marketing from North Central College, Naperville, Ill.

Dennis Tze - VP of Client Services

As VP of Client Services, Dennis is responsible for managing and growing Mall Networks client programs to achieve client satisfaction and revenue goals. Those activities include strategic engagement planning, program execution, consumer marketing and account management.

Dennis brings more than 15 years of experience in loyalty programs, consumer marketing, merchant relations and strategic consulting to Mall Networks. Before Mall Networks, Dennis spent 10 years at American Express, most recently as Vice President of the OPEN Savings® program, a built-in loyalty program that generated over $150MM in savings for all OPEN cardmembers and included 20 industry leading small business focused companies such as FedEx, Delta Airlines, Hertz and Courtyard Marriott.

During his tenure at American Express, Dennis worked in several business groups (Merchant Services, Consumer Card, OPEN for Small Business) in a diverse set of roles (Partnerships, Marketing, Acquisitions, Business Development, Reengineering). Before American Express, Dennis worked for an international management consulting firm and for a pharmaceutical company.

He originally hails from Canada where he received an MBA from the Ivey School of Business at University of Western Ontario and completed his undergraduate work at McGill University.
